This desirable, decadent and deranged pair of sandals is the Jean Paul Gaultier Kim.
Aside from being a sandal and bootie hybrid, it also appears to be a mix of a ballet shoe and gladiator sandal. I admit that it’s leaning more towards “ballet recital” than “gladiator arena”, but that’s mostly because it’s in a metallic light pink color than anything else. Try imagining it in black or brown and it’s practically the Jean Paul Gaultier Uma boots only in a more girly color.
I like looking at theĀ Jean Paul Gaultier Kims, but are you as stumped as I am about what to wear with these sandal booties? These shoes are meant to be seen so pants or anything that covers them up is a no, but short skirts with these would look too tarty and “ballet school reject”.
